Abstract
A system is disclosed for sequentially illuminating segments of vehicle LED arrays of tail lights, when running lights are “on”, in response to incremental changes in vehicle speed. In response to rapid vehicle deceleration above a predetermined threshold, the system cyclically moves a darkened segment across an illuminated array of LED brake lights with or without the operator applying the brakes.

11. A method of visibly signaling vehicle speed utilizing tail lights comprising:
-
(a) providing at least one tail light on the vehicle having an array of discrete illuminators; (b) providing an on-board power supply; (c) providing an onboard sensor connected to the power supply and operable to output an electrical signal (VR) indicative of vehicle road speed; and (d) providing an electronic control unit (ECU) and connecting the ECU to the power supply and connecting the ECU for receiving the sensor output VR; and (e) sensing changes in predetermined increments of road speed sensor output VR and when running lights are “
on”
illuminating all illuminators and then sequentially and cumulatively moving a darkened (de-energized) discrete segment cyclically at a rate in the range of 0.5-20 Hz across the array of illuminators to the margin thereof in response thereto. - View Dependent Claims (12)

13. A method of visibly signaling vehicle deceleration a rate greater than a predetermining threshold utilizing vehicle tail lights comprising:
-
(a) providing an on-board power supply; (b) providing at least one tail light having an array of discrete illuminators; (c) providing a road speed sensor and connecting the sensor to the power supply and outputting an electrical signal indicative of vehicle road speed (VR); (d) providing an electronic controller and connecting the ECU to the power supply, sensor, and at least one tail light; (e) determining the occurrence of a negative time rate of change of increments of VR (−
dVR/dt) with the ECU and outputting an illuminating signal to the at least one tail light array and illuminating all discrete illuminators in the array when −
dVR/dt exceeds a predetermined threshold; and(f) darkening (de-energizing) a band of the discrete illuminators and progressively moving the darkened band of the illuminators cyclically at a rate in the range of 0.5-20 Hz from an initial location on the array over the array to a margin thereof. - View Dependent Claims (14, 15)
